Wie Ersetze ich ein bestimmtes Bild auf einer Webseite mit einem anderen Bild?
Gibt es diese Website, die hat ein Bild, das ich ersetzen möchte. Genau wie die Skripte, die den hintergrund ersetzen einer Seite, wie Google.
In der html -, es ist in img scr
. Wie kann ich ersetzen, die spezifische Quelle auf der Seite mit einer anderen Quelle, so dass jedes mal, wenn ich die Seite aufrufen, zeigt es das Bild, das ich will, anstatt die, die ' s normalerweise gibt es?
- Wie wollen Sie laden dieser Website? Wie wollen Sie die ersetzen Sie das Bild? Javascript? CSS?
- Was meinst du? Möchten Sie Sie ersetzen es dynamisch, wenn Menschen mit Ihrem add-on/script besuchen Sie die Seite? Wenn ja, versuchen Greasemonkey.
- Haben Sie wollen, ändern Sie einfach den html code um das Bild zu ändern, die Art und Weise?
- Ja, ich möchte, um es zu ersetzen dynamisch.
- Es ist in HTML nicht möglich, es ist eine statische Sprache, die Sie verwenden müssen, eine dynamische Sprache wie PHP oder ASP.net für serverside (immer beim laden der Seite) oder Javascript für die client-Seite (jedes mal, wenn Sie tun, eine bestimmte Sache in der Seite).
- Warum in der Welt wollen Sie das tun?
Du musst angemeldet sein, um einen Kommentar abzugeben.
Wenn Sie nur wollen, um es zu ändern für sich selbst, Greasemonkey ist ideal. Es ermöglicht Ihnen die Ausführung eines Skripts (Kerin bietet einen Ausgangspunkt) bei jedem Besuch der Seite. Sehen Sie diese Greasemonkey-tutorials.
Eine browser-Erweiterung kann diese Aufgabe für Sie. Ich bin vertraut mit, wie dies mit Requestly, die mein Freund gemacht hat.
Als Beispiel möchte ich demonstrieren, wie Sie ersetzen würden, das Google-logo Bild mit Bing-logo-Bild mit einer einfachen Regel:
und dann auf Neuladen der Seite nach dem aktivieren der Regel:
EDIT: Es scheint, dass Sie möchten, ersetzen Sie ein Bild auf einer Website, die nicht Ihnen gehört. Wenn Sie nicht über legitime Zugriff auf die Website webserver oder CMS-system, es gibt nichts Sie tun können. Ich lasse den rest von meinem Beitrag unten, nur für den Fall habe ich falsch interpretiert:
Ich gehe davon aus, dass Sie dies tun wollen in Javascript, wie Sie Ihre post tagged mit "Skript." Andere script-Sprachen vorhanden, natürlich, aber nur Javascript hat wirklich eine sinnvolle installierten Basis.
Zuerst weisen Sie dem Bild eine ID, so etwas wie:
Dann, in deinem Javascript, die Sie verändern können, das Bild in der Quelle so auf:
Können Sie diese Technik ziemlich weit, auch das hinzufügen Dinge auf den image-tag wie: